Heim >Web-Frontend >CSS-Tutorial >Wie kann ich in CSS übergeordnete OBJECT-Elemente auswählen, die PARAM-Elemente enthalten?

Wie kann ich in CSS übergeordnete OBJECT-Elemente auswählen, die PARAM-Elemente enthalten?

Susan Sarandon
Susan SarandonOriginal
2024-12-19 11:18:08788Durchsuche

How Can I Select Parent OBJECT Elements Containing PARAM Elements in CSS?

„Übergeordnete“ Elemente in CSS finden

Das Problem, mit dem Sie konfrontiert sind, besteht darin, „übergeordnete“ Elemente in CSS auszuwählen, insbesondere alle OBJECT-Elemente zu finden die PARAM-Elemente enthalten. Auch wenn Sie vielleicht versucht haben, den Selektor „OBJECT PARAM“ zu verwenden, stimmt dieser nur mit dem PARAM-Element überein, nicht mit dem OBJECT, das es enthält.

Bedauerlicherweise verfügt CSS derzeit nicht über übergeordnete Selektoren, trotz mehrerer Vorschläge im Laufe der Jahre. Daher gibt es keine native Möglichkeit, den gewünschten Effekt ausschließlich durch CSS-Regeln zu erzielen.

Alternative Lösungen

Um diese Einschränkung zu überwinden, sollten Sie alternative Methoden verwenden, wie zum Beispiel:

  • jQuery oder VanillaJS: Verwenden Sie JavaScript, um nach PARAM-Elementen zu suchen und dann auf deren übergeordnete Elemente zuzugreifen OBJECT-Elemente.
  • Klassenanmerkungen: Fügen Sie den PARAM-Elementen eine zusätzliche Klasse hinzu, sodass Sie deren übergeordnete OBJECT-Elemente in CSS als Ziel festlegen können.

Ähnliche Diskussionen

Ähnliche Fragen wurden in der Vergangenheit aufgeworfen, was zu Folgendem führte Diskussionen:

  • Gibt es einen CSS-Elternselektor?
  • CSS-Eltern-/Vorfahrenselektor
  • Komplexer CSS-Selektor für Eltern des aktiven Kindes

Das obige ist der detaillierte Inhalt vonWie kann ich in CSS übergeordnete OBJECT-Elemente auswählen, die PARAM-Elemente enthalten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n